Bill overview
This bill seeks to reclassify the United Nations Relief and Works Agency for Palestine Refugees in the Near East (UNRWA) as a Foreign Terrorist Organization (FTO) by the U.S. Department of State. It directs the Secretary of State to make this designation within 10 days of the bill’s enactment. Supporters of the bill argue this action is necessary to address concerns about UNRWA’s potential support for terrorism and misuse of funds. The bill’s passage would significantly impact UNRWA’s operations and funding within the United States.
